NSWCPS Bar Award for Excellence in Swimming
Thomas McCormack has demonstrated exceptional talent, dedication, and versatility in swimming throughout 2024. His remarkable achievements at diocesan, state, and national levels reflect his commitment to excellence and his ability to compete at the highest level.
At the Diocesan and Polding Championships, Thomas showcased his skill with a first-place finish in the 50m Breaststroke and podium placements in the 200m Individual Medley and other events. At the NSWPSSA Championships, he secured gold in the 50m Breaststroke and bronze in the 200m IM, earning selection to represent New South Wales at the School Sport Australia Championships.
On the national stage, Thomas won a bronze medal in the 50m Breaststroke and contributed to two gold-medal relay victories in the Freestyle and Medley Relays. His ability to perform under pressure and excel in team and individual events underscores his talent and teamwork.
In addition to his swimming success, Thomas represented NSW in rugby league and rugby union, earning a team gold medal in rugby league. Balancing multiple sports with such success highlights his resilience, discipline, and work ethic.
